Layer 1 & Smart Contract Platforms
Base blockchains that settle their own transactions and run smart contracts directly on their main network.
Layer 2 & Scaling
Networks built on top of a Layer 1 to raise throughput and cut fees while inheriting the base chain's security.
DeFi
Decentralized finance protocols that recreate trading, lending and derivatives with smart contracts instead of intermediaries.
Stablecoins
Tokens engineered to hold a steady value, usually pegged to a fiat currency such as the US dollar.
Real World Assets (RWA)
Tokens representing ownership or claims on off-chain assets such as treasuries, commodities and private credit.
